Overview

A large predatory shark similar to a great white, with a torpedo‑shaped body, gray skin, and rows of serrated teeth. Its dorsal fin cuts the water like a knife and its eyes are black and cold.

Official SRD 5.2.1 Stat Block

Hunter Shark

Large, Beast, Unaligned

Official SRD5e-2024srd-5.2.1-v1PDF Ready
Download PDF

This stat block uses official SRD 5.2.1 content under CC-BY-4.0 attribution.

Armor Class12
Hit Points45 (6d10 + 12)
Challenge2 β€’ 450 XP
Proficiency+2
Speed
Swim 40 ft.
Initiative
+1
Saving Throws
β€”
Skills
Perception +2
Senses
Blindsight 30 ft.; Passive Perception 12
Passive Perception
12
Languages
None
STR18+4
DEX13+1
CON15+2
INT1-5
WIS10+0
CHA4-3

Traits

Blood Frenzy

The shark has Advantage on melee attack rolls against any creature that doesn't have all its Hit Points.

Water Breathing

The shark can breathe only underwater.

Actions

Bite

Melee Attack Roll: +6, reach 5 ft. Hit: 13 (2d8 + 4) Piercing damage.
